WebPrinciples of essentialism. Essentialists’ goals are to instill students with the “essentials” of academic knowledge, patriotism, and character development through traditional (or back-to-basic) approaches. This is to promote reasoning, train the mind, and ensure a common culture for all citizens. WebNov 7, 2024 · Essentialists believe that there is a common core of knowledge that needs to be transmitted to students in a systematic, disciplined way.
